Problem 17-32 (Algorithmic) (LO. 6) Wan's AGI last year was $298,000. Her Federal income tax came to $89,400, paid through both withholding and estimated payments. This year, her AGI will be $447,000, with a projected tax liability of $67,050, all to be paid through estimates. Wan wants to pay the least amount of tax during the year that does not incur a penalty. If required, round intermediate calculations to two decimal place and your final answer to the nearest dollar. a. Compute Wan's total estimated tax payments for this year. Under the current-year method: Under the prior-year method: $ b. Assume instead that Wan's AGI last year was $136,000 and resulted in a Federal income tax of $27,200. Determine her total estimated tax payments for this year. Under the current-year method: $ Under the prior-year method: $
